莫名其妙,当输入账密后,linux“本机“陷于登录循环,就是无法进入系统
奇怪的是putty还可以登录,这不失是个好消息,先putty登录后看看日志,linux登录日志默认在/var/log/secure中
[root@o19csvr security]# tail -f secure
再于本机尝试登录,可以看到日志如下
Sep 15 22:04:30 o19csvr login: PAM unable to dlopen(/lib/security/pam_limits.so): /lib/security/pam_limits.so: cannot open shared object file: No such file or directory
Sep 15 22:04:30 o19csvr login: PAM adding faulty module: /lib/security/pam_limits.so
Sep 15 22:04:37 o19csvr login: pam_unix(login:session): session opened for user root by LOGIN(uid=0)
Sep 15 22:04:37 o19csvr login: Module is unknown
日志显示不知道/lib/security/pam_limits.so这个模组,依提示去/lib/security下看是空的,find一下看看
[root@o19csvr security]# find / -name pam_limits.so
/lib64/security/pam_limits.so
结果在/lib64/security/有看到这个模组,不管他,link过来看看
[root@o19csvr security]# ln /lib64/security/pam_limits.so /lib/security/pam_limits.so
再尝试本机登录后,看到久违的画面了
至于原因嘛,不知道,在之前我仅安装过tigervnc,也许是这个原因吧,有知道的吗?